Line a baking sheet with parchment paper and set aside.
Chop strawberries into small pieces.
Add the strawberries, yogurt, honey, and vanilla to a mixing bowl.
Stir until everything is evenly coated.
Scoop spoonfuls of the mixture onto the baking sheet to form clusters.
Freeze the clusters for 1–2 hours, or until completely solid.
In a microwave-safe bowl, melt chocolate chips and coconut oil in short intervals, stirring until smooth.
Remove the frozen clusters from the freezer.
Dip each cluster into the melted chocolate, coating it fully.
Place coated clusters back onto the parchment paper.
Freeze again for about 10 minutes to harden the chocolate.
Enjoy straight from the freezer or allow to soften slightly before eating.
